Abstract
We relate base change functors of sheaves in ${\mathbb A}^1$-homotopy theory to group change functors from equivariant homotopy theory, and use these functors to construct elements of the Picard group of the ${\mathbb A}^1$-stable homotopy category. We also prove an analogue of the Wirthmüller isomorphism from equivariant homotopy theory in the ${\mathbb A}^1$-context.
